Common Carrier Air Duct Cleaning Problems We Solve in Fresno
- Infinity blower motor thermal trips in summer. Carrier’s variable-speed motors overheat when Fresno’s 105°F weeks combine with duct debris restricting airflow. We see this most in older 93701–93706 tract homes where decades of agricultural dust have narrowed duct passages. Cleaning restores designed airflow before the motor’s thermal limiter starts tripping.
- Tule fog algae in evaporator drain pans. The dense winter ground fog unique to the San Joaquin Valley floor keeps humidity elevated for weeks. Carrier evaporator coils grow algae that clogs condensate lines — we’ve responded to water damage calls where the pan overflowed into ceilings. Our chemical coil treatment and line clearing prevents this.
- Agricultural dust abrasion in flex duct liners. Almond orchard dust near 93706 and 93707 is sharper than household dust. It abrades Carrier flex duct inner liners, creating pinhole leaks that bypass filtration entirely. We video-inspect to locate damage, then seal or replace sections.
- ECM control board failures from PM2.5 accumulation. Carrier’s electronically commutated motors in north Fresno’s 1990s–2000s builds collect valley fine particulate on control boards. Intermittent fan failures result. We clean boards and housings without disturbing factory calibrations.
- Harvest-season evaporator coil fouling. During August–October, raisin grape drying and almond shaking create dust concentrations that coat Carrier coils with a sugary film. Chemical treatment is required — standard rinsing won’t touch it. This failure mode doesn’t exist outside agricultural metros.
Carrier Service in Fresno: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Fresno sits at the center of the San Joaquin Valley air basin, which the American Lung Association consistently ranks as the most polluted air region in the United States. This isn’t abstract data for Carrier owners — it’s a trapped bowl of agricultural dust from surrounding Fresno County farms, wildfire smoke funneled down from the Sierra Nevada foothills, and diesel particulates from the Highway 99 freight corridor. Your ducts accumulate fine PM2.5 at rates genuinely higher than virtually any other major U.S. city.
For Carrier systems specifically, this means maintenance intervals that would be adequate in Sacramento or Bakersfield fall short here. The Infinity Series’ precision airflow sensors — designed for normal suburban dust loads — flag errors earlier in Fresno. Performance Series units in 93722 and 93723 work harder, longer, pulling more contaminated air through the same filter surface. We’ve found that Carrier owners in the 93706 ZIP, closest to the heaviest agricultural activity, benefit from duct inspection every 18 months rather than the national 3-year recommendation. Carrier Models & Products We Service in Fresno
We work on the full Carrier residential line: Infinity Series with Greenspeed intelligence, Performance Series, and Comfort Series including older R-22 units still running in central Fresno’s 1950s–1970s housing stock.
For Infinity Series electronics, we recommend OEM replacement parts to maintain any remaining warranty compatibility. Greenspeed control boards and variable-speed motors don’t forgive incorrect specs. For older Comfort Series units where OEM is no longer manufactured, we source high-quality aftermarket filters and components that meet original airflow ratings.

Carrier Service Pricing in Fresno
| Service |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Standard air duct cleaning (single system) | $280 – $400 |
| Air duct cleaning with evaporator coil treatment | $380 – $520 |
| Video inspection (standalone or add-on) | $85 – $150 |
| Duct sealing (per system) | $200 – $350 |
| Dryer vent cleaning (bundled) | $75 – $125 |
What drives cost: system accessibility (crawlspace vs. attic), contamination level from agricultural dust exposure, whether coil cleaning or sealing is added, and flex-duct condition in north Fresno’s 1990s–2000s builds.
